Dense Busway — Sandwich Bus Duct 250A–6300A
Dense (sandwich-type) busway distributes high-current power from transformers and switchgear to loads with compact, low-impedance busbar construction. Rated 250–6300 A, 380V/400V/690V, with copper or aluminum conductors, insulated busbars in a compact housing, and plug-in tap-off units for flexible load connection in data centers and industrial plants.

Selection Guide
Rating
Size the busway current to the connected load with derating for ambient and enclosure.
Conductor
Choose copper for higher conductivity or aluminum for lower cost.
Protection
Specify IP54 or higher for dusty or humid installations.
- Frequently Asked Questions
What is dense busway?
Dense (sandwich) busway is a compact busbar system where phase conductors are tightly stacked with thin insulation, giving low impedance and low voltage drop for high-current distribution.
How is busway tapped for loads?
Plug-in tap-off units insert at intervals along the run, allowing loads to be added or moved without de-energizing the main bus.
What current range is typical?
250–6300 A for low-voltage distribution, with higher ratings available for special applications.
